![]() Clearly, something needs to change, and it's best to start with educating our children on how to behave around dogs and understand canine behavior. In the vast majority of documented dog aggression and dog bite cases, the child knew the dog well. Further studies reveal how dog aggression is often linked to children, and new research found that kinds rarely know how to approach frightened or angry dogs (and it's a huge problem). The data shows that 79 percent of fatal dog attacks are on children, too. Statistics from The Center for Disease Control and Prevention reveal that half of all children 12 years of age and under have been bitten by a dog ( source). The importance of educating kids about dogs ![]() ![]() Parents can also be naive about the amount of training and preparation that is required to help their dog adjust to being around children. Inquisitive and boisterous children are often very unaware of how their actions could provoke a dangerous attack from a dog. ![]() Dogs and children can be wonderful companions that enrich each other’s lives but when relationships go wrong, the consequences can be devastating. As dog owners and parents we have a responsibility to care for and nurture our children and dogs in a safe environment. ![]()
